i remember seeing kellen moore(i think?) talking about the opening drive script and how it’s structured to see how the defense is reacting to different formations and alignment and the purpose of the drive isn’t necessarily to score a td but to get a feel for what plays might be available later (obviously scoring is the overall goal)

last year we started slow and tended to grow into the game later. i really feel like this year KP has not gotten a handle on that because it really does feel like we get shut down bad after the first drive because we are not adjusting. it seems like the players are being more vocal this year in communicating what they are seeing so they can adjust so hopefully it keeps improving as the season goes on.
